  1. Talking Cure

    Talking Cure is an installation that includes live video processing, speech recognition, and a dynamically composed sound environment. It is about seeing, writing, and speaking — about word pictures, the gaze, and cure. It works with the story of Anna O, the patient of Joseph Breuer's who gave to him and Freud the concept of the "talking cure" as well as the word pictures to substantiate it. The reader enters a space with a projection surface at one end and a high-backed chair, facing it, at another. In front of the chair are a video camera and microphone. The video camera's image of the person in the chair is displayed, as text, on the screen. This "word picture" display is formed by reducing the live image to three colors, and then using these colors to determine the mixture between three color-coded layers of text. One of these layers is from Joseph Breuer's case study of Anna O. Another layer of text consists of the words "to torment" repeated — one of the few direct quotations attributed to Anna in the case study.

  2. Contemplating Flight

    Framed by various folktales, "Contemplating Flight" explores established female representations and further tests the limitations of participation in a challenging narrative grammatology.

    Artist Statement:
    Like previous artworks on 6amhoover.com "Contemplating Flight" explores the interplay between digital narrative, image and interaction. It aims to question the paradigm of interaction equating to empowerment.

    Bettelheim like many ponders the importance of the forest "Since ancient times the near impenetrable forest in which we get lost has symbolized the dark, hidden, near-impenetrable world of our unconscious. If we have lost the framework which gave structure to our past life and must now find our way to become ourselves, and have entered this wilderness with an as yet undeveloped personality, when we succeed in finding our way out we shall emerge with a much more highly developed humanity." The Uses Of Enchantment: The Meaning And Importance of Fairy Tales 1976.
